Our principles

Ethics and integrity are central to our culture and that of our customers. To support them in tackling societal challenges and meeting high ethical and legal standards, we apply several key principles to the design of Videris. These inform how we build and deploy our software, the services we offer and our contractual relationships with our customers.

tick icon

Public information only

Videris can only be used to research publicly available and licensable information. It doesn’t gather non-public information, nor does it interact or engage with a third party, including investigative subjects.

tick icon

Focused data collection

Videris helps investigators maximise the accuracy and relevance of the data they collect. It supports proportionate investigations and does not collect bulk or non-targeted data.

 

tick icon

Human judgment

Videris enhances the skills of human investigators and doesn’t make decisions on their behalf. It collects data on the instruction of an analyst, not an algorithm.

 

tick icon

Accountability

Videris enables legal and policy compliance to support consistency, auditability and accountability.

 

Our Customers

Our customers include major international banks, governments and global corporates, who use Videris to stop crime and make the world a safer place. They all have legitimate use-cases, often required by law or by a regulator.
